Typical Welding Flaws



Numerous common welding defects can endanger the integrity of bonded frameworks, causing possible failures if not addressed. Among these problems, porosity is just one of the most common, characterized by the existence of little gas pockets entraped within the weld steel. This can substantially deteriorate the joint, leading to minimized structural stability.




An additional problem is incomplete fusion, which occurs when the weld metal falls short to adequately fuse with the base material or previous weld layers. This absence of bonding can develop weak factors that may fall short under tension. Likewise, absence of penetration refers to inadequate deepness of weld metal, stopping the joint from achieving its designated toughness.


Fractures can also establish during the welding procedure, usually because of rapid air conditioning or unsuitable welding criteria. These fractures may circulate under lots, leading to disastrous failures. In addition, excessive spatter can prevent the weld's high quality by introducing impurities.


Inspection Methods and Approaches



Reliable assessment techniques and approaches are vital for making certain the stability and long life of welded frameworks. A detailed evaluation regime employs a selection of non-destructive testing (NDT) methods to detect possible problems without compromising the welded elements. Amongst the most generally utilized strategies are aesthetic evaluation, ultrasonic screening, radiographic testing, magnetic bit screening, and dye penetrant testing.


Visual examination acts as the initial line of protection, enabling assessors to determine surface area defects such as cracks, imbalances, or incomplete fusion. Ultrasonic testing makes use of high-frequency sound waves to identify interior imperfections, offering thorough details concerning the product's integrity. Radiographic testing utilizes X-rays or gamma rays to picture the internal framework of welds, making it possible for the recognition of additions and spaces.


Magnetic fragment screening works for detecting surface and near-surface discontinuities in ferromagnetic materials, while dye penetrant testing highlights surface-breaking issues using tinted dyes. Each approach has its unique advantages and limitations, requiring a calculated mix to attain comprehensive examination coverage. Applying these strategies methodically makes sure that any kind of prospective problems are determined early, promoting the dependability and toughness of bonded frameworks.
